    Since I mostly use recycled fabrics everything is washed. I iron and starch my pre-washed fabrics before I cut, When I buy new fabrics to finish out a mostly recycled quilt, I take them to the basin and rinse them until the dyes don't run. I like to iron them and fold them on 5 inch square cards if they are small or 12 inch cardboards if they are large. That makes storage neater.

    I did not used to wash the fabric before I cut it unless it was red or intense blue, but lately I need to wash and dry all fabric before I start piecing. My stash is too big to go back and wash it all, so I just do it as I go. I starch before I cut and sometimes after the blocks are made.
